[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of composite film positioning and transmission, in particular to a composite film positioning and transmission device. Background Art

[0002] During the production process of composite film, it is necessary to apply paint on the surface of the film. After drying, the paint becomes a uniform coating, thus obtaining a composite film. In the process of applying the paint on the surface of the film, the film needs to be flattened. In the process of directionally transporting the film, the paint is applied to the film, so a transmission device is required.

[0003] A Chinese patent with application publication number CN 110203740 A discloses a film conveying positioning control device, including a frame, on which a conveying mechanism, a positioning control mechanism and a winding mechanism are arranged in sequence along the conveying direction of the film. The positioning control mechanism includes a correction controller and an induction probe electrically connected to the correction controller. A cross bar is provided on the frame, and sliding bars are respectively installed at both ends of the cross bar. The sliding bar is provided with an adjustment component for installing the induction probe, and the adjustment component includes a first rotating arm and a second rotating arm hinged to each other, and a sleeve is fixedly connected to the end of the first rotating arm that is not hinged to the second rotating arm. The sleeve is sleeved on the sliding bar and can move along the axial direction of the sliding bar. The induction probe is installed on the end of the second rotating arm that is not hinged to the first rotating arm. The two induction probes are arranged opposite to each other. The induction probe of this scheme can be adaptively adjusted according to films of different widths, and the adjustment method is convenient.

[0004] During the transmission process of the composite film, the existing positioning and transmission device is unable to accurately position the rolls on the pay-out roller and the take-up roller, resulting in a large error in the relative position of the two rolls, resulting in poor positioning accuracy of the composite film; therefore, a composite film positioning and transmission device is proposed to address the above problem. [0021] See also Figure 5 As shown, a mounting plate 23 is installed on the base 1, and a lifting groove 24 is provided on the mounting plate 23. A stepping motor 25 is installed on the mounting plate 23 through the machine base. The stepping motor 25 is connected to the control panel 2 through an internal circuit. A second screw rod 26 is installed on the output shaft of the stepping motor 25. The second screw rod 26 is rotatably installed on the inner wall of the lifting groove 24. A lifting block 27 is assembled in the lifting groove 24, and a mounting block 28 is mounted on the lifting block 27. The mounting block 28 has a moving groove 29, and a moving block 30 is assembled in the moving groove 29. A tensioning roller 31 is rotatably installed on the moving block 30, a first electrode sheet 32 ​​is installed on the bottom side of the moving block 30, and a second electrode sheet 33 is installed on the inner wall of the moving groove 29. An indicator light 34 is installed on the side wall of the mounting plate 23, and the indicator light 34 is connected to the control panel 2 through an internal circuit. The control panel 2 is connected, the indicator light 34 is connected to the first electrode sheet 32 ​​and the second electrode sheet 33 through the internal circuit, and two groups of support plates 35 are installed on the base 1, and guide rollers 36 are rotatably installed on the support plates 35; when working, the existing positioning and transmission device cannot conveniently adjust the tension of the composite film 7 during the transmission of the composite film 7, resulting in poor convenience in adjusting the tension of the composite film 7. The loosening component and the winding component operate simultaneously, and the control panel 2 controls the two first motors 4 to operate, driving the loosening roller 5 and the winding roller 8 to rotate synchronously. The loosening roller 5 loosens the composite film 7 thereon, and then the composite film 7 passes around the two guide rollers 36 and the tensioning roller 31, and finally the winding roller 8 winds up the composite film 7, thereby realizing the transmission of the composite film 7;

[0022] During this process, the tension adjustment component operates, and the tension roller 31 moves vertically downward under the action of its own gravity, driving the moving block 30 thereon to move vertically downward, and the moving block 30 drives the first electrode sheet 32 ​​thereon to move vertically downward, so that the first electrode sheet 32 ​​contacts the second electrode sheet 33. At this time, the internal circuit of the indicator light 34 is connected, and the indicator light 34 sends an electrical signal to the control panel 2. After receiving the electrical signal, the control panel 2 controls the stepper motor 25 to operate, driving the second screw rod 26 to rotate, and the second screw rod 26 drives the lifting block 27 thereon to move vertically downward, and the lifting block 27 drives the mounting block 28 to move vertically downward, and the mounting block 28 drives the moving block 30 thereon to move vertically downward, and the moving block 30 drives the tension roller 31 thereon to move vertically downward until the tension roller 3 is tensioned. 1 contacts the composite film 7 and continuously presses the composite film 7 downward, so that the composite film 7 is in a tensioned state. When the composite film 7 is in a tensioned state, the composite film 7 will block the tensioning roller 31, and the tensioning roller 31 will not continue to move downward, but the mounting block 28 will continue to move downward, so that the first electrode sheet 32 ​​and the second electrode sheet 33 are quickly separated, and the electrical signal of the indicator light 34 disappears. At this time, the control panel 2 controls the stepping motor 25 to stop operating, so that the mounting block 28 stops moving downward, thereby realizing the adjustment of the tension of the composite film 7. When the composite film 7 becomes loose again, the above steps are repeated, and the tensioning roller 31 adjusts the tension of the composite film 7 again. This structure can autonomously adjust the tension of the composite film 7, which is conducive to improving the convenience of adjusting the tension of the composite film 7.
